#!/bin/sh
###########################################
# Update php4.4.0 to php4.4.2
###########################################
# Vor dem Update zu Installieren
#------------------------------------------
# flex
# openssl-devel
# Apache2-devel
# Bison
# zlib-devel
# libxml2-devel
# libpng-devel
# t1lib-devel
# openldap2-devel
# libmcrypt-devel
# curl-devel
# freetype2-devel
# imap-devel
# postgresql-devel
# ypbind
# mysql_devel
# Libjpeg
###########################################
# Source anlegen und laden
cd /usr/local/src/
mkdir php4.4.2
cd php4.4.2
wget
http://de.php.net/get/php-4.4.2.tar.gz/from/this/mirror
tar -xzf php-4.4.2.tar.gz
cd php-4.4.2
# php.ini sichern
cp /etc/php.ini /etc/php.ini.sav
# configure
./configure --prefix=/usr --datadir=/usr/share/php --mandir=/usr/share/man --bindir=/usr/bin --libdir=/usr/share --includedir=/usr/include --sysconfdir=/etc --with-_lib=lib --with-config-file-path=/etc --with-exec-dir=/usr/lib/php/bin --disable-debug --enable-inline-optimization --enable-memory-limit --enable-magic-quotes --enable-safe-mode --enable-sigchild --disable-ctype --disable-session --without-mysql --disable-cli --without-pear --with-openssl --with-apxs2=/usr/sbin/apxs2-prefork i586-suse-linux
# apache stoppen
rcapache2 stop
# build
make
# install
make install
# config neu laden
ldconfig
# apache starten mit php4.4.2
rcapache2 start